﻿function validateForm(AForm)
{

	 //4. stanowisko
    if (!(AForm.stanowisko.selectedIndex > 0 &&
        AForm.stanowisko.selectedIndex <= 3)) {
        alert("Proszę wybrać stanowisko.");
        return false;
    };
	
    //1. Imię
    reg = /^[0-9-\ a-zA-ZąćęłńóśżźĄĆĘŁŃÓŚŻű]{2,80}$/;
    wyn = AForm.imie.value.match(reg);
    if (wyn == null) {
        alert("Proszę podać poprawne imie i nazwisko. " +
              "Musi zawierać od 2 do 80 liter. " +
              "Żadne znaki poza literami nie są dozwolone.");
        return false;
    }
	
		
	//1. data urodzenia
    reg = /^[0-9-\ a-zA-ZąćęłńóśżźĄĆĘŁŃÓŚŻű]{2,40}$/;
    wyn = AForm.data_urodzenia.value.match(reg);
    if (wyn == null) {
        alert("Proszę podać datę urodzenia. ");
        return false;
    }
	
	//1. obywatelstwo
   // reg = /^[a-zA-ZąćęłńóśżźĄĆĘŁŃÓŚŻű]{2,40}$/;
  //  wyn = AForm.obywatelstwo.value.match(reg);
  //  if (wyn == null) {
  //      alert("Proszę podać obywatelstwo. ");
  //      return false;
 //   }
	
	//1. pesel
    reg = /^[0-9]{2,20}$/;
    wyn = AForm.pesel.value.match(reg);
    if (wyn == null) {
        alert("Proszę podać numer PESEL. " +
		"Poprawny numer powinien się składać z samych cyfr." );
        return false;
    }
	
	//nip
//	reg = /^[0-9]{2,20}$/;
  //  wyn = AForm.nip.value.match(reg);
 //   if (wyn == null) {
 //       alert("Proszę podać numer NIP. " +
//		"Poprawny numer powinien się składać z samych cyfr." );
 //       return false;
//    }
	
	//1. zameldowanie
   // reg = /^[a-zA-ZąćęłńóśżźĄĆĘŁŃÓŚŻ]{2,200}$/;
   // wyn = AForm.zameldowanie.value.match(reg);
	//if (wyn == null) {
   //     alert("Proszę podać dokładny adres zameldowania. ");
   //     return false;
  //  }
	
	//seria
	//reg = /^[a-zA-Z0-9ąćęłńóśżźĄĆĘŁŃÓŚŻű]{2,20}$/;
    //wyn = AForm.dokument.value.match(reg);
   // if (wyn == null) {
   //     alert("Proszę podać serię dokumentu tożsamości. ");
   //     return false;
  //  }

	//rnumer
//	reg = /^[0-9-\ ]{2,20}$/;
  //  wyn = AForm.numer.value.match(reg);
 //   if (wyn == null) {
 //       alert("Proszę podać numer dokumentu tożsamości. "  );
 //       return false;
 //   }

	//1. wydany przez
  //  reg = /^[0-9-\ a-zA-ZąćęłńóśżźĄĆĘŁŃÓŚŻű]{2,50}$/;
 //   wyn = AForm.wydany.value.match(reg);
 //   if (wyn == null) {
 //       alert("Proszę wpisać, kto wydał dokument tożsamości. " );
 //       return false;
 //   }
	
	
       //3. Email
   // reg = /^[a-zA-Z0-9ąćęłńóśżźĄĆĘŁŃÓŚŻű]{1,30}@[a-zA-Z0-9ąćęłńóśżźĄĆĘŁŃÓŚŻű]+(\.[a-zA-Z0-9ąćęłńóśżźĄĆĘŁŃÓŚŻű]+)+$/;
   // wyn = AForm.email.value.match(reg);
  //  if (wyn == null) {
   //     alert("Proszę podać poprawny adres email. " +
   //           "Poprawny adres musi zawierać małpę " +
   //           "oraz co najmniej dwa człony nazwy serwera, " +
   //           "np. a@b.c lub ochroniarz@ma.giwerę.com.");
   //     return false;
   // }

	//telefon
	reg = /^[0-9-\ ]{2,20}$/;
    wyn = AForm.telefon.value.match(reg);
    if (wyn == null) {
        alert("Proszę podać numer telefonu wraz z nr. kierunkowym w jednym ciągu. "  );
        return false;
    
    };

    return true;
}

